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0940493516 55305 1654
57 45666848 89871420105
57 45666848 89871420105
2600 98034089 59
All about undefined
Interested in learning more?
57 45666848 89871420105
2600 98034089 59
See more
92149 026 78653440785
13 539 979432 701329141 01
See more
8552851091 98161506432 8440
395157 78805384 97476239961 4317130366
See more